PM Modi's remarks at I2U2 Summit

Published By : Admin | July 14, 2022 | 16:51 IST

Your Excellency, Prime Minister Lapid,


Your Highness, Sheikh Mohamed Bin Zayed Al Nahyan,

Your Excellency, President Biden,


First of all, many congratulations and best wishes to Prime Minister Lapid on assuming the office as the Prime Minister.

I would also like to thank him for hosting today's summit.

This is a meeting of strategic partners in the true sense.

We are all good friends too, and we all have common perspective and common interests as well.

Excellencies, Your Highness,

" I2U2" has set a positive agenda right from today's first summit.

We have identified Joint Projects in many areas, and have also prepared a roadmap to move forward in them.

Under the " I2U2" framework, we have agreed to increase joint investment in six key areas of water, energy, transport, space, health and food security.

It is clear that the vision and agenda of "I2U2" is progressive and practical.

By mobilizing the mutual strengths of our countries - Capital, Expertise and Markets - we can accelerate our agenda, and contribute significantly to the global economy.

Our cooperative framework is also a good model for practical cooperation in the face of increasing global uncertainties.

I am confident that with " I2U2", we will make significant contributions to energy security, food security and economic growth on a global scale.

Prime Minister extends greetings on Global Tiger Day, reaffirms commitment to tiger conservation
July 29, 2026

The Prime Minister, Shri Narendra Modi, has extended greetings to all wildlife enthusiasts on Global Tiger Day.

The Prime Minister said that the people of India are proud that the country is home to almost 70 per cent of the global tiger population.

He noted that India’s tiger conservation efforts are inspired by the country’s centuries-old culture of living in harmony with nature and powered by the collective will of its people.

Shri Modi reaffirmed the commitment to science-based conservation, community participation and sustainable development that strengthens tiger conservation.

Shri Modi also lauded the efforts and dedication of forest personnel, scientists and conservationists for their key role in tiger protection. The Prime Minister added that India remains committed to empowering local communities and reducing human-wildlife conflict.
